Inside the Berkeley AI Bootcamp Experience
The Berkeley AI bootcamp—officially titled the Professional Certificate in Machine Learning and Artificial Intelligence—is an online program developed by the Berkeley Haas School of Business. Spanning six months, this AI ML bootcamp delivers a rigorous, flexible, and immersive experience designed for working professionals aiming to gain cutting-edge skills without pausing their careers.
What You Will Learn in This Berkeley AI Bootcamp
The program is thoughtfully segmented into three main sections, each building on the last to ensure a layered and comprehensive learning journey:
1. Foundations of ML/AI
This section sets the groundwork with:
- Python programming fundamentals, including Jupyter Notebooks and version control via GitHub
- Core concepts in data analysis, statistical inference, and visualization
- Exploration of the data science life cycle through real-world business problems
- Tools: Google Colab, pandas, Seaborn, Plotly, Codio
2. ML/AI Techniques
Attending this AI bootcamp online, participants delve into essential modeling and machine learning strategies:
- Linear and logistic regression, classification, decision trees, and k-nearest neighbors
- Clustering techniques (such as k-means) and dimensionality reduction with PCA
- Time series forecasting and model evaluation strategies, including regularization
- In-depth use of scikit-learn for hyperparameter tuning and model optimization
3. Advanced Topics and Capstone Project
In this final phase, learners focus on modern innovations and apply everything they have learned:
- Generative AI applications and prompt engineering with tools like ChatGPT
- Natural language processing (NLP) and recommendation systems
- Deep neural networks, ensemble models, and algorithmic design
- A capstone project where learners tackle an industry-relevant challenge, creating a professional portfolio on GitHub that demonstrates their applied skills
Each section includes real-world applications, industry case studies, and progressively complex assignments that build confidence and competence.
Structured for Hands-On Learning
Unlike many theoretical online programs, this artificial intelligence bootcamp from Berkeley emphasizes practical experience through:
- Interactive coding activities embedded in every module, from building decision trees to cleaning unstructured datasets
- Tools integration with Python libraries, real-world datasets, and visualization platforms
- Weekly schedules that blend recorded lectures, live mentorship, and peer discussions
Learners of this AI bootcamp can expect to dedicate 15–20 hours per week, working through 24 modules that simulate real challenges and mirror the collaborative environments found in modern tech teams.
